Access World is Hiring a Sourcing Specialist, Logistics and Freight Forwarding Near Houston, TX

Access World is a global Freight & Project forwarding and commodities warehousing company including logistics business. Active in more than 30 countries, we offer complete logistics, storage and supply chain solutions, tailor-made to our customer requirements for various commodities including metals and minerals, soft commodities, chemicals, renewables, oil & gas, project and general cargo. We are an approved warehouse keeper of the London Metal Exchange (LME) and Chicago Mercantile Exchange (CME), and we provide warehousing and associated logistics and value-added service to traders, producers, financiers and consumers of non-ferrous and ferrous metals, ferroalloys and minor metals etc. Our worldwide offices and operations span across Africa, Asia Pacific, Europe & Middle East, and US. Each region operating in semi-autonomous offices with their own corporate functions including Commercial, Finance, HR, Compliance & Legal, Customer Service, and Operations.

Purposes of the position:

We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Sourcing Specialist to join our dynamic team in the logistics and freight forwarding industry. The successful candidate will be responsible for sourcing services across various transportation modes, including airfreight, sea freight, rail, warehouse, and project cargo. The role involves negotiating payment terms, qualifying and onboarding vendors, and obtaining competitive rates to ensure cost-effective and efficient logistics solutions.

Reports to: Business Development Manager, Projects and Freight Forwarding

Responsibilities and Accountabilities:

  • Sourcing:
    • Identify and evaluate potential suppliers for various logistics services, including airfreight, sea freight, rail, warehouse, and project cargo.
    • Build and maintain strong relationships with key suppliers to ensure a reliable and diverse vendor base.
  • Negotiation:
    • Negotiate favorable terms, pricing, and contracts with suppliers to achieve cost savings and optimize service quality.
    • Collaborate with internal stakeholders to understand specific requirements and negotiate contracts that meet business needs.
    • Drive continuous improvement initiatives with suppliers to enhance service levels and reduce costs.
  • Payment Terms:
    • Negotiate and establish payment terms with suppliers to align with company financial objectives.
    • Monitor and manage payment processes to ensure adherence to agreed-upon terms.
  • Rate Management:
    • Obtain and analyze competitive rates for various transportation modes and logistics services.
    • Maintain a comprehensive rate database and regularly review and update pricing structures.
    • Work closely with the finance and operations teams to ensure accurate and timely cost information.
  • Project Cargo Experience:
    • Utilize project cargo expertise to manage sourcing and logistics requirements for special projects.
    • Collaborate with project teams to develop tailored logistics solutions and ensure successful project execution.
  • Communication Skills:
    • Verbal and written communication skills.
    • Strong project management, organizational, and analytical skills required.
    • Conducts business dealings with the highest level of integrity and regard for corporate guidelines, legal and environmental regulations.
    • Excellent team facilitation and presentation skills required.

Specific requirements for the position: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Logistics, Supply Chain Management, Business, or a related field.
  • Proven experience as a Sourcing Specialist or similar role in the logistics/freight forwarding industry.
  • Strong negotiation skills with a track record of achieving cost savings.
  • Familiarity with all modes of transportation (airfreight, sea freight, rail) and logistics services (warehouse, project cargo).
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Project management experience in the logistics industry is advantageous.
